PROGRAM OVERVIEW

The Bachelor of Church Management (B.Ch.M) is a comprehensive undergraduate program designed to prepare students for effective leadership, administration, and management within churches and Christian organizations. The program integrates biblical principles, organizational leadership, financial stewardship, ministry administration, and strategic planning to equip graduates for responsible and Christ-centered service. Students develop practical skills in church operations, leadership development, team management, communication, and ministry administration while gaining a strong theological and ethical foundation. The program prepares future leaders to manage churches, ministries, and faith-based organizations with wisdom, integrity, and excellence.

PROGRAM AT A GLANCE

Program Duration: 4 Years (8 Semesters)

Total Credit Hours: 136

Delivery Mode: Coursework + Research + Ministry Practicum

Teaching System: Semester System (Distance Learning)

Session Begin: 1st March and 1st September every year

Medium of Instruction: English Medium

Department: Ecclesiastical Leadership and Applied Ministries

Faculty: Church Management

ADMISSION CRITERIA

Applicant must hold a Diploma of Church Management, or equivalent from an approved institution.
